site stats

Onpopstate event

WebEvent Occurs When; popstate: The window's history changes: PopStateEvent Properties. Property Returns; state: An object containing a copy of the history entries: Inherited … Web对我司自研的前端监控系统的前端SDK进行总结 navigator. 使用 window.navigator 可以收集到用户的设备信息,操作系统,浏览器信息... PV. History 利用了 HTML5 History Interface 中新增的 pushState() 和 replaceState() 方法进行路由切换,是目前主流的无刷新切换路由方式。

WindowEventHandlers.onpopstate - Web APIs - W3cubDocs

WebcomponentDidUnmount () { window.onpopstate = () => {} } For dom event listeners, this is different. It is common for react apps to act like single page apps, where new elements … Web15 de jun. de 2024 · 2、响应式. 说明. Vue 的响应式原理是核心是通过 ES5 的保护对象的 Object.defindeProperty 中的访问器属性中的 get 和 set 方法,data 中声明的属性都被添加了访问器属性,当读取 data 中的数据时自动调用 get 方法,当修改 data 中的数据时,自动调用 set 方法,检测到数据 ... greenville new york restaurants https://oversoul7.org

PopStateEvent - Web APIs MDN - Mozilla Developer

Web24 de nov. de 2024 · Firstly we use pushState to create a new history entry, and it becomes the current position in the history stack because I would change nothing, so the page looks the same. After that, if users press the back button from the browser, an event popstate will fire and we can catch it. Code inside in the event handle block creates the infinite loop, … Web27 de nov. de 2024 · Your code does not work. Event onpopstate is never fired so no alert is executed. I tested similar code in my app but alert also is never fired. Maybe VUE … WebThe popstate event of the Window interface is fired when the active history entry changes while the user navigates the session history. It changes the current history entry to that of the last page the user visited or, if history.pushState () has been used to add a history entry to the history stack, that history entry is used instead. Syntax greenville north carolina children\u0027s hospital

PopStateEvent - Web APIs MDN - Mozilla Developer

Category:自研前端监控系统总结(SDK篇)-行为监控 - CodeAntenna

Tags:Onpopstate event

Onpopstate event

popstate - APIs da Web MDN - Mozilla Developer

WebPopStateEvent Index Properties AT_ TARGET BUBBLING_ PHASE CAPTURING_ PHASE Event NONE bubbles cancel Bubble cancelable composed current Target default Prevented event Phase is Trusted return Value src Element state target time Stamp type Methods composed Path init Event prevent Default stop Immediate Propagation stop … Web[0:46] Onpopstate is defined as handler function. We will use it to dispatch a state change using the setPressed function. Now, we just render the state using the value of pressed that is a Boolean. We use toString method to show it in the screen.

Onpopstate event

Did you know?

Web8 de abr. de 2024 · 1. The second argument you pass to removeEventListener has to be the function you want to remove. You are passing a different function, which hasn't been registered as an event handler, so nothing happens. Declare your event handler as a function with a reference you can reuse. Then use that reference for both … WebO evento popstate apenas é disparado após uma ação no navegador como um click no botão de voltar (ou chamando history.back () por javascript) Navegadores tendem a lidar …

Web8 de jan. de 2024 · Some way to subscribe to router events in my app.component and cancel the current navigation on certain conditions without having to add a route guard to every route in my app and without messing up the history. In AngularJS, I managed to achieve this with following code in app.run() , so I would like to be able to do the same in … WebTo react on popstate event, you need to push some state onto the session history. For example add this line to the document ready section: history.pushState (null, null, …

Web31 de dez. de 2015 · 这些方法可以协同window.onpopstate事件一起工作。 使用history.pushState()会改变referrer的值,而在你调用方法后创建的 XMLHttpRequest 对象会在 HTTP 请求头中使用这个值。referrer的值则是创建 XMLHttpRequest 对象时所处的窗口的 URL。 pushState(any data, string title, [string url]) WebHandling window.onpopstate events. The window.onpopstate event is fired automatically by the browser when a user navigates between history states that a developer has set. …

Web6 de dez. de 2024 · You can catch history back using "window.onpopstate" event. ⭐But AFAIK it is only available in HTML5. http://www.whatwg.org/specs/web-apps/current-work/multipage ...

Webwhen using: window.onpopstate = function (e) { var d = e.state {data: 'no state'}; $ ('#state').text (d.data); }; http://jsfiddle.net/jBHgU/ the history can pop up the pushed state. but when using: $ (window).on ('popstate', function (e) { var d = e.state {data: 'no state'}; $ ('#state').text (d.data); }); http://jsfiddle.net/hQTTX/1/ fnf starting screen musicWebA popstate event is dispatched to the window every time the active history entry changes. If the history entry being activated was created by a call to pushState or affected by a call to replaceState, the popstate event's state property contains a copy of the history entry's state object. See window.onpopstate for sample usage. fnf starting screenWeb2 de abr. de 2024 · The onpopstate event. This event is called on window every time the active history state changes, with the current state as the callback parameter: window. onpopstate = event => {console. log (event.state)} will log the new state object (the first parameter passed to pushState or replaceState) every time you call history.back(), … greenville nh to nashua nhgreenville nh surveyor mediumWeb1 de nov. de 2016 · This doesn't check whether the navigation was back or forward. This solution works for all versions of Angular. import { PlatformLocation } … greenville north carolina convention centerWebE.G. window.onpopstate = function (event) { if (event && event.state) { // Process this. resetting here. // E.G. if needing to set a product tab as selected based on the selectedproduct in the state... this.productToHighlight = event.state.selectedproduct; } }; Is this possible in an LWC? fnf starvation alleyWebconstructor (public platformStrategy: LocationStrategy) { super (1); platformStrategy.onPopState (event => this._update ('pop')); const browserBaseHref = this.platformStrategy.getBaseHref (); this._baseHref = stripTrailingSlash (stripIndexHtml (browserBaseHref)); this._update ('push'); } greenville non emergency police number